RAIN POV

The forest was a blur of shadows and snarls as Batista and I tore through the trees, our breaths coming in sharp bursts. My legs burned, but I didn't slow down—not with the sound of claws ripping into the dirt behind us. Victoria's wolves were right on our heels.

"Faster!" Batista barked, glancing over his shoulder.

"I am fast!" I shot back, my voice rough with anger and adrenaline. "Don't trip and leave me, or I swear I'll haunt you!"

We swerved between trees, ducking under branches that clawed at our clothes. The scent of blood and fur was thick in the air, and my heart pounded like a war drum in my chest. But we weren't just running—we were leading them. Straight into our trap.

When we burst into the clearing, the moonlight spilled over the place like silver fire. This was it—the site we'd set days ago, just in case things went bad.

They had gone bad.
